Trim & Baseboard Replacement After Water Damage v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Extensive water damage to multiple areas of your home No Yes Professional crews can handle multiple areas quickly and efficiently.
Hidden water damage behind walls or under flooring No Yes Professionals have the right equipment to detect and repair hidden damage.
Water damage to load-bearing walls or structural elements No Yes Professionals can ensure the structural integrity of your home is maintained.
Water damage to electrical or gas lines No Yes Professionals can safely repair or replace damaged lines.
Water damage to high-priority areas, such as kitchens or bathrooms No Yes Professionals can quickly restore these critical areas.
Water damage to small, isolated areas Yes No You can handle small areas with DIY techniques and materials.
